Conquering Your Coin Laundry Experience
Washing clothes in a coin-operated laundry can be a real pain, but it doesn't have to be. With a little planning and these useful tricks, you can make your next laundromat visit smooth sailing. First, always look over the dryers before you start to ensure they're in working order. Then, determine the correct amount of detergent based on the load size and soil level. Don't overload the machines for optimal cleaning and efficiency.
- Organize your garments into whites, colors, and delicates before you start.
- Select the correct cleaning product
- Pay attention to the timer so you don't overwash your garments.
And finally, fold your clothes promptly to avoid wrinkles and frustration. Happy laundering!

Top Laundromat Tips: For a Clean and Efficient Wash
Heading to the laundromat? No worries, it doesn't have to be a hassle! With these helpful tricks, you can make your laundry day breeze. First, always check your garments for any spots and pre-treat them before tossing them in the drum.
- Choose the right volume washer for your load. Overloading can lead to subpar washing.
- Use the correct amount of detergent based on the amount of your load and water heat level. Don't forget fabric softener for a fresh scent.
- Be mindful of your laundry during the wash cycle.
- If possible, get there in advance to avoid crowds
Folding your clothes straight from the tumble dryer will help prevent wrinkles. And lastly, don't forget to remove your laundry promptly!
